Özet
Two new (2 and 8) and eight known (1, 3-7, 9 and 10) o-, m-, p-nitro, -methoxy and -methyl substituted chalconoid and alnustone-like compounds with a skeleton of (2E,4E)-1,5-diarylpenta-2,4-dien-1-one (1-10) were synthesized and their 4n(π) photocyclization reaction gave 10 new o-, m-, p-nitro, -methoxy and -methyl substituted cis-3-benzoyl-4-phenylcyclobutenes (11-20), stereoselectively, as major products in solution. The antimicrobial activities of all the compounds were also investigated. They showed antibacterial activity against Gram-positive bacteria, moderate antibacterial activity against Gram-negative bacteria, but no antifungal activity was observed against yeast-like fungi. © 2005 Elsevier B.V.
